AARP Medicare Supplement plans are insured and sold by private insurance companies like UnitedHealthcare to help limit the out-of-pocket costs associated with Medicare Parts A and B. Supplement plans can help pay for some or all of the costs not covered by Original Medicare things like coinsurance and deductibles.
AARP/UnitedHealthcare offers most Medigap plan types often with multiple options for pricing and extra benefits. Prices are competitive, and complaint rates for the companys Medicare Supplement Insurance plans are considerably lower than the market average.

Plan G from AARP/UnitedHealthcare costs $142 per month, on average. Plan G is the best Medicare Supplement plan if you are newly eligible for Medicare. It offers the most coverage of any Medigap plan, except for Plan F which is only available to those who became eligible for Medicare before Jan. 1, 2020.
Medicare Supplement insurance doesnt have restrictions on enrollment periods the way other Medicare coverage does. As long as youre enrolled in Original Medicare, Part A and Part B, you can apply for a Medicare Supplement insurance plan anytime.
